What is Ethereum open interest?

Ethereum open interest is the total notional value of every outstanding ETH perpetual contract across the exchanges PerpDexWars tracks — a direct measure of how much leveraged capital is committed to Ethereum right now. Rising OI means fresh positions are opening; falling OI means positions are closing or being liquidated. Read against price, it separates moves backed by new conviction from those driven by forced exits.

ETH open interest is often read alongside the staking and basis backdrop: because spot ETH can earn a yield, changes in perpetual OI reflect demand to take leveraged directional exposure rather than hold staked spot. The per-exchange breakdown shows whether that leverage is concentrating on one venue — a fragility signal — or spread broadly across the market.

Frequently asked

What is Ethereum open interest?

Ethereum open interest is the total USD notional value of all outstanding ETH perpetual futures contracts that have not been settled or closed. It measures how much capital is actively deployed in leveraged Ethereum positions across every exchange PerpDexWars tracks.

Why does Ethereum open interest across exchanges matter?

No single exchange shows the full picture. OI spread across many exchanges means the market is broadly capitalized; OI concentrated on one exchange creates fragility, since a liquidation or outage there can cascade. The per-exchange breakdown shows where ETH leverage is building.

What does rising or falling Ethereum OI signal?

Rising OI means new positions are opening — fresh capital entering. Falling OI means positions are closing, by choice or liquidation. OI rising with price signals a trend backed by conviction; OI falling as price rises often signals a short squeeze rather than organic demand.

How does ETH staking relate to open interest?

Because spot ETH can earn a staking yield, demand to be long with leverage shows up in the perpetual basis and in open interest. Rising ETH OI alongside a positive basis signals strong appetite for leveraged upside rather than simply holding staked spot.
